Since 1972 Nella Golanda, Landscape Sculptor
(Athens School of Fine Arts, honorary member of the Pan-Hellenic Association
of Landscape Architects 2008) has applied “TOTAL ART”
in public spaces, re-establishing in human scale the relation between
nature and historical landscape, aiming to regenerate life to the contemporary
metropolitan cities. The visitors are guided to experience new different
ways and develop new social relations in public spaces. These “live” sculptures
function as interactive experimental landscapes where the creation of new art
genres is possible. Art gets out of the museums and becomes a part of everyday
life.

1. The INHABITED SCULPTED PUBLIC
SPACES,
belong to everyday visitors, they are not isolated,
they are not property of museums or private collections, they are parts of
urban everyday life, contributing to the formation of new human relations.

2003 - 04 First prize at the artistic competition organized by the metro-isap SA, for an elongated
wall sculpture at the station of N. Herakleion
.Realization of the project entitled “Day and Night - Kites and
Constellations” (dimensions 30mΧ3mΧ0.5m laser-perforated inox plates, neon light, fluorescent signal colors). In
collaboration with Aspassia Kouzoupi.

2007 Installation and exhibition
of A. Kouzoupi’s
SIGNAUX HYBRIDES in the city of Saint Tropez. (design+construction Α. Kouzoupi, consultant N. Golanda). Signaux Hybrides are a system of hybrid signalization/ public art,
a concept for signalizing the cultural mutation of the city during the event Dialogues Méditerranèens.
